Leptin regulation of bone resorption by the sympathetic nervous system and CART

Article Abstract:

An analysis of beta2-adrenergic receptors (Adrb2) deficient mice the sympathetic nervous system favors bone resorption by increasing expression in osteoblast progenitor cells of the osteoclast differentiation factor Rankl. Studies establish that the Leptin- regulated neutral pathways control both aspects of bone remodeling and that integrity of sympathetic signaling is necessary for the increase in bone resorption caused by gonadal failure is specified

The complexities of skeletal biology

Article Abstract:

This review discusses skeletal biology and pathology as applied to the management of cartilage and bone disease. Recent advances in molecular and genetic approaches have revealed that skeleton is not an amorphous tissue but is prone to several genetic and degenerative diseases. The author discusses the present understanding of the skeletal diseases and some therapeutic approaches to treat them.

Deciphering skeletal patterning: clues from the limb

Article Abstract:

This review discusses the developmental aspects of skeletal pattern drawing information from the studies on limb development in chicken and mouse embryos. Research points out that our understanding of skeletal pattern development is still limited despite large amount of knowledge about cartilage and bone formation and their genetics.
